1,3-β-D-葡聚糖和抗白念珠菌芽管抗体检测对侵袭性念珠菌病诊断的临床价值

摘要: 目的 探讨1,3-β-D-葡聚糖(BG)和抗白念珠菌芽管抗体(CAGTA)对侵袭性念珠菌病(IC)的诊断和治疗监测的临床价值。方法 收集IC患者26例、念珠菌定植者100例。动态监测患者血浆BG和血清抗CAGTA含量,分析2项指标单用和联合应用诊断IC的敏感性、特异性、阳性预测值及阴性预测值,分析其与抗真菌治疗疗效间的关系。结果 单用BG和抗CAGTA诊断IC的敏感性、特异性、阳性预测值、阴性预测值分别为61.5%、90.0%、61.5%、90.0%和57.7%、83.0%、46.9%、88.3%;BG和抗CAGTA联合检测诊断IC的特异性和阳性预测值均达100.0%,明显高于单项检测。抗真菌治疗有效组随着抗真菌治疗时间的延长,BG和抗CAGTA含量逐渐下降;治疗无效组BG和抗CAGTA含量呈持续上升趋势。结论 联合监测BG和抗CAGTA不仅能提高IC诊断的特异性和阳性预测值,而且对IC的早期诊断和治疗监测具有潜在应用价值。

Abstract: Objective To investigate the clinical significance to diagnose and monitor invasive candidiasis (IC) using 1,3-beta-D-glucan (BG) and anti-Candida albicans germ tube antibody (CAGTA). Methods The clinical specimens were collected from 26 patients infected IC and 100 patients colonized Candida.BG and CAGTA were detected and monitored dynamically. Sensitivity, specificity, positive and negative predictive values of the detection of BG or CAGTA and the combination detection of BG and CAGTA were analyzed. The relationship between the 2 markers and antifungal therapy was analyzed. Results The sensitivities, specificities, positive and negative predictive values of BG and CAGTA detections were 61.5%,90.0%,61.5%,90.0% and 57.7%,83.0%,46.9%,88.3%, respectively. As the combination detection of BG and CAGTA was performed, the specificity and positive predictive value, each up to 100.0%, were significantly higher than those of individual detections. The BG and CAGTA values in the effective group receiving antifungal therapy showed a gradual decline.The BG and CAGTA values varied with a upward trend in the ineffective group. Conclusions The combination detection of BG and CAGTA can improve specificity and positive predictive value for the diagnosis of IC, and it is very useful for the early diagnosis and therapeutic monitoring of IC.
